题目:编程求出3个数字中的最大值和最小值

代码:

package com.homework;import java.util.Scanner;public class 最大最小值 {public static void main(String[] args) {//编程求出3个数字中的最大值和最小值System.out.println("请输入三个数字");Scanner scanner=new Scanner(System.in);int a=scanner.nextInt();int b=scanner.nextInt();int c=scanner.nextInt();if(a>=b) {if(c>=a) {System.out.println("最大值为:"+c+" "+"最小值为:"+b);}else if(a>=c&&c>=b) {System.out.println("最大值为:"+a+" "+"最小值为:"+b);}else {System.out.println("最大值为:"+a+" "+"最小值为:"+c);}}else {if(c>=b) {System.out.println("最大值为:"+c+" "+"最小值为:"+a);}else if(b>=c&&c>=a) {System.out.println("最大值为:"+b+" "+"最小值为:"+a);}else {System.out.println("最大值为:"+b+" "+"最小值为:"+c);}}}
}

效果:

请输入三个数字
67
98
12
最大值为:98 最小值为:12

Java基础——最大最小值相关推荐

  1. Java基础---数组练习(最大值、最小值的索引)

    Java基础–数组练习 1.将一维数组的遍历,封装成方法public static void arrayBianli(int[] arr) {for(int i = 0;i<arr.length ...

  2. Java笔记整理-02.Java基础语法

    1,标识符 由英文字母.数字._(下划线)和$组成,长度不限.其中英文字母包含大写字母(A-Z)和小写字母(a-z),数字包含0到9. 标识符的第一个字符不能是数字(即标识符不能以数字开头). 标识符 ...

  3. Java基础概念性的知识总结

    属于个人的所学的知识总结,不是全面的 1.JDK.JRE和JVM三者的区别 01.JDK:(Java Development ToolKit)Java开发工具包,是整个Java的核心.包括了Java的 ...

  4. java如何创造一个整数的类_【技术干货】Java 面试宝典:Java 基础部分(1)

    原标题:[技术干货]Java 面试宝典:Java 基础部分(1) Java基础部分: 基础部分的顺序:基本语法,类相关的语法,内部类的语法,继承相关的语法,异常的语法,线程的语法,集合的语法,io 的 ...

  5. Java基础day6

    Java基础day6 Java基础day6 debug和基础练习 1 debug模式 1.1 什么是debug模式 1.2 debug模式操作 2 基础练习 2.2.1 减肥计划if版本 2.2.2 ...

  6. JAVA基础知识|lambda与stream

    lambda与stream是java8中比较重要两个新特性,lambda表达式采用一种简洁的语法定义代码块,允许我们将行为传递到函数中.之前我们想将行为传递到函数中,仅有的选择是使用匿名内部类,现在我 ...

  7. java基础之lambda表达式

    java基础之lambda表达式 1 什么是lambda表达式 lambda表达式是一个匿名函数,允许将一个函数作为另外一个函数的参数,将函数作为参数传递(可理解为一段传递的代码). 2 为什么要用l ...

  8. Java基础篇1——变量与数据类型

    Java基础篇1--变量与数据类型 1.标识符命名规则 标识符以由大小写字母.数字.下划线(_)和美元符号($)组成,但是不能以数字开头. 大小写敏感 不能与Java语言的关键字重名 不能和Java类 ...

  9. java实现次方的运算_【技术干货】Java 面试宝典:Java 基础部分(1)

    海牛学院的 | 第 616 期 本文预计阅读 |18 分钟 Java 基础部分 基础部分的顺序:基本语法,类相关的语法,内部类的语法,继承相关的语法,异常的语法,线程的语法,集合的语法,io 的语法, ...

最新文章

  1. import和from...import
  2. tcp/ip 协议栈Linux内核源码分析八 路由子系统分析三 路由表
  3. Oracle官方文档网址收录
  4. 简单使用JDOM解析XML
  5. Ribbon 客户端负载均衡
  6. python计算数组元素的和_python中数组的运算
  7. LeetCode 583. 两个字符串的删除操作(动态规划)
  8. 所有锁的unlock要放到try{}finally{}里,不然发生异常返回就丢了unlock了
  9. 互联网公司是如何腐败的?
  10. unity有用资源的导出未package便于在其他工程用的问题解决
  11. 北理工珠海学院计算机分数线,北京理工大学珠海学院
  12. 好玩好用软件推荐,让你大开眼界
  13. 小龙秋招【面试笔记】正式发布,速来围观!(已有40+同学斩获大厂offer)
  14. python 灰度图像_Python灰度图像到3个通道
  15. oracle漏洞pdf,Oracle DBA手记 4 数据安全警示录 pdf完整扫描版版
  16. fatal error C1189
  17. 50个最有价值的数据可视化图表(推荐收藏)
  18. c语言如何实现人民币转换编程,C语言成序设计实现人民币小写金额与大写金额的转换.docx...
  19. 小程序-手写签名(附代码)
  20. 名帖105 赵孟頫 楷书《玄妙观重修三门记》

热门文章

  1. jQuery animate动画效果
  2. 广东省工程类人才需求暴涨
  3. 油猴高正确率循环等待网页答题(原创)
  4. java毕业生设计学生培训管理系统计算机源码+系统+mysql+调试部署+lw
  5. 企业内网反向代理百度地图服务
  6. IE11线上显示pdf文件以及pdf.js用法
  7. lazada根据ID取商品详情详细解析?(详细解释)
  8. x86_64与ARM64的signaling NaN与Quiet NaN,以及浮点数的舍入模式
  9. C++ 中对浮点数的输出控制
  10. 基于区块链的侧链技术,有了Lisk为什么还要做ASCH?